maraschino
/mærəˈʃiːnoʊ/Definitions
1. noun
a sweet, cherry-flavored liqueur made from cherries, especially Marasca cherries, and often used in cocktails.
“The bartender added a splash of maraschino to the classic Negroni recipe.”
2. adjective
relating to or characteristic of the Marasca cherry or its juice.
“The maraschino flavor was a key component in the traditional Italian dessert.”
3. proper noun
a liqueur made by Luxardo, an Italian company that produces a sweet, cherry-flavored liqueur made from Marasca cherries.
“Luxardo is famous for its high-quality maraschino liqueur.”
